Home
last modified time | relevance | path

Searched refs:demux (Results 1 – 25 of 45) sorted by relevance

12

/hardware/interfaces/tv/tuner/1.0/vts/functional/
DVtsHalTvTunerV1_0TargetTest.cpp37 sp<IDemux> demux; in configSingleFilterInDemuxTest() local
44 ASSERT_TRUE(mDemuxTests.openDemux(demux, demuxId)); in configSingleFilterInDemuxTest()
46 mFilterTests.setDemux(demux); in configSingleFilterInDemuxTest()
60 sp<IDemux> demux; in testTimeFilter() local
63 ASSERT_TRUE(mDemuxTests.openDemux(demux, demuxId)); in testTimeFilter()
66 mFilterTests.setDemux(demux); in testTimeFilter()
79 sp<IDemux> demux; in broadcastSingleFilterTest() local
91 ASSERT_TRUE(mDemuxTests.openDemux(demux, demuxId)); in broadcastSingleFilterTest()
93 mFrontendTests.setDemux(demux); in broadcastSingleFilterTest()
94 mFilterTests.setDemux(demux); in broadcastSingleFilterTest()
[all …]
DDemuxTests.cpp19 AssertionResult DemuxTests::openDemux(sp<IDemux>& demux, uint32_t& demuxId) { in openDemux() argument
23 demux = demuxSp; in openDemux()
DDemuxTests.h45 AssertionResult openDemux(sp<IDemux>& demux, uint32_t& demuxId);
/hardware/interfaces/tv/tuner/1.1/vts/functional/
DVtsHalTvTunerV1_1TargetTest.cpp29 sp<IDemux> demux; in configSingleFilterInDemuxTest() local
36 ASSERT_TRUE(mDemuxTests.openDemux(demux, demuxId)); in configSingleFilterInDemuxTest()
38 mFrontendTests.setDemux(demux); in configSingleFilterInDemuxTest()
39 mFilterTests.setDemux(demux); in configSingleFilterInDemuxTest()
68 sp<IDemux> demux; in reconfigSingleFilterInDemuxTest() local
78 ASSERT_TRUE(mDemuxTests.openDemux(demux, demuxId)); in reconfigSingleFilterInDemuxTest()
80 mFrontendTests.setDemux(demux); in reconfigSingleFilterInDemuxTest()
81 mFilterTests.setDemux(demux); in reconfigSingleFilterInDemuxTest()
104 sp<IDemux> demux; in mediaFilterUsingSharedMemoryTest() local
114 ASSERT_TRUE(mDemuxTests.openDemux(demux, demuxId)); in mediaFilterUsingSharedMemoryTest()
[all …]
DDemuxTests.cpp19 AssertionResult DemuxTests::openDemux(sp<IDemux>& demux, uint32_t& demuxId) { in openDemux() argument
23 demux = demuxSp; in openDemux()
DDemuxTests.h45 AssertionResult openDemux(sp<IDemux>& demux, uint32_t& demuxId);
DFrontendTests.h135 void setDemux(sp<IDemux> demux) { getDvrTests()->setDemux(demux); } in setDemux() argument
/hardware/interfaces/tv/tuner/aidl/vts/functional/
DVtsHalTvTunerTargetTest.cpp42 std::shared_ptr<IDemux> demux; in configSingleFilterInDemuxTest() local
49 ASSERT_TRUE(mDemuxTests.openDemux(demux, demuxId)); in configSingleFilterInDemuxTest()
51 mFrontendTests.setDemux(demux); in configSingleFilterInDemuxTest()
52 mFilterTests.setDemux(demux); in configSingleFilterInDemuxTest()
80 std::shared_ptr<IDemux> demux; in reconfigSingleFilterInDemuxTest() local
90 ASSERT_TRUE(mDemuxTests.openDemux(demux, demuxId)); in reconfigSingleFilterInDemuxTest()
92 mFrontendTests.setDemux(demux); in reconfigSingleFilterInDemuxTest()
93 mFilterTests.setDemux(demux); in reconfigSingleFilterInDemuxTest()
113 std::shared_ptr<IDemux> demux; in testTimeFilter() local
116 ASSERT_TRUE(mDemuxTests.openDemux(demux, demuxId)); in testTimeFilter()
[all …]
DDemuxTests.cpp25 AssertionResult DemuxTests::openDemux(std::shared_ptr<IDemux>& demux, int32_t& demuxId) { in openDemux() argument
29 demux = mDemux; in openDemux()
35 AssertionResult DemuxTests::openDemuxById(int32_t demuxId, std::shared_ptr<IDemux>& demux) { in openDemuxById() argument
38 demux = mDemux; in openDemuxById()
DDemuxTests.h37 AssertionResult openDemux(std::shared_ptr<IDemux>& demux, int32_t& demuxId);
38 AssertionResult openDemuxById(int32_t demuxId, std::shared_ptr<IDemux>& demux);
DFrontendTests.h109 void setDemux(std::shared_ptr<IDemux> demux) { getDvrTests()->setDemux(demux); } in setDemux() argument
DFilterTests.h114 void setDemux(std::shared_ptr<IDemux> demux) { mDemux = demux; } in setDemux() argument
DDvrTests.h139 void setDemux(std::shared_ptr<IDemux> demux) { mDemux = demux; } in setDemux() argument
/hardware/interfaces/tv/tuner/1.0/
DIDvrCallback.hal21 * Notify the client a new status of the demux's record.
23 * @param status a new status of the demux's record.
28 * Notify the client a new status of the demux's playback.
30 * @param status a new status of the demux's playback.
DIDemux.hal31 * Set a frontend resource as data input of the demux
34 * this demux instance. A demux instance can have only one data source.
44 * Open a new filter in the demux
46 * It is used by the client to open a filter in the demux.
63 * Open time filter of the demux
65 * It is used by the client to open time filter of the demux.
109 * It is used by the client to release the demux instance. HAL clear
119 * Open a DVR (Digital Video Record) instance in the demux
140 * It is used by the client to connect CI-CAM. The demux uses the output
154 * It is used by the client to disconnect CI-CAM. The demux will use the
DITuner.hal63 * @return demuxId newly created demux id.
64 * @return demux the newly created demux interface.
66 openDemux() generates (Result result, DemuxId demuxId, IDemux demux);
DIDescrambler.hal27 * Set a demux as source of the descrambler
29 * It is used by the client to specify a demux as source of this
33 * @param demuxId the id of the demux to be used as descrambler's source.
DIFilter.hal30 * Message Queue. The data in FMQ is filtered out from demux input or upper
80 * will be stopped and removed automatically if the demux is closed.
134 * A filter uses demux as data source by default. If the data was packetized
140 * use demux as data source if the filter instance is NULL.
/hardware/interfaces/tv/tuner/1.1/default/
DTimeFilter.cpp31 TimeFilter::TimeFilter(sp<Demux> demux) { in TimeFilter() argument
32 mDemux = demux; in TimeFilter()
DTimeFilter.h43 TimeFilter(sp<Demux> demux);
/hardware/interfaces/tv/tuner/1.0/default/
DTimeFilter.cpp31 TimeFilter::TimeFilter(sp<Demux> demux) { in TimeFilter() argument
32 mDemux = demux; in TimeFilter()
DTuner.cpp128 sp<Demux> demux = new Demux(demuxId, this); in openDemux() local
129 mDemuxes[demuxId] = demux; in openDemux()
131 _hidl_cb(Result::SUCCESS, demuxId, demux); in openDemux()
DTimeFilter.h47 TimeFilter(sp<Demux> demux);
/hardware/interfaces/tv/tuner/aidl/default/
DTimeFilter.cpp33 TimeFilter::TimeFilter(std::shared_ptr<Demux> demux) { in TimeFilter() argument
34 mDemux = demux; in TimeFilter()
DTimeFilter.h38 TimeFilter(std::shared_ptr<Demux> demux);

12